The community at a glance
r/nearprotocol is a Subreddit for Crypto Investors with roughly 22K members. It has been around since 2018. It uses a forum format for communication.
Roughly 2K members have joined in the past year.

- What platform is r/nearprotocol on?
- r/nearprotocol runs on Reddit. Reddit communities (or "subreddits") are forum-based groups on the popular social news aggregation, web content rating, and discussion website Reddit. Reddit is commonly known as "the front page of the internet". Users submit content to the site such as links, text posts, and images, which are then voted up or down and discussed by other members.
